Description
You will manage and optimize NoSQL database deployments to ensure stability and performance.
Responsibilities
- Manage MongoDB and Aerospike deployments, including configuration, performance tuning, and best practice implementation.
- Own incident, change, release, and problem management processes.
- Execute capacity planning, backup and restore procedures, log rotation, and retention policies.
- Collaborate with application developers to optimize queries and improve database execution plans.
- Develop automation, monitoring tools, and scripts to improve fault tolerance and environment stability.
Required Skills
- 7+ years of experience in database administration.
- Hands-on experience with NoSQL configuration and performance tuning.
- Deep understanding of cross data center replication (XDR), partitions, migrations, and master-replica concepts.
- Practical experience with sharding and identifying suitable indexes.
- Proficiency with Linux commands and shell or Python scripting.
- Experience with SaltStack, PowerShell, and/or Ansible.
- Ability to develop Splunk queries and create dashboards.
- Experience with alerting and monitoring implementations.
- Degree in any field of study.
Preferred Skills
- Knowledge of in-memory data stores.